AC Installation Costs in Appleton

New central AC installation costs in Appleton, by system type and brand.

ServiceLowAverageHigh
Window unit
$168$392$784
Ductless mini-split (single zone)
$2,240$5,040$8,960
Central AC replacement (existing ducts)
$3,920$7,280$13,440
Central AC new install (with ductwork)
$7,840$13,440$22,400
Carrier (residential)
$4,256$6,944$11,760
Trane (residential)
$5,600$9,856$15,232
Lennox (residential)
$3,920$7,280$13,440
Rheem (residential)
$3,584$6,160$10,080

Prices reflect continental metro averages compiled from published industry cost guides, contractor surveys, and regional labor data. Last updated: April 2026.

AC Installation in Appleton, WI: What to Expect

Appleton's continental climate creates a concentrated but critical demand for cooling during its short summer months. High temperatures reach the low 80s with humidity levels that make indoor comfort essential from June through August. The region's six HVAC contractors maintain an impressive average rating of 4.7 based on nearly 500 customer reviews, reflecting a professional community capable of handling AC Installation in Appleton for both new construction and replacement projects.

Pricing for air conditioning systems varies significantly based on household needs. Window units range from $168 to $784, while ductless mini-split systems cost between $2,240 and $8,960. For homes with existing ductwork, central AC replacement typically runs $3,920 to $13,440. Since Wisconsin has no statewide HVAC license, Appleton contractors hold local credentials that verify their expertise and compliance with regional building codes.

Frequently Asked Questions

New AC installation in Appleton costs $168-$22,400 depending on system type. Window units run $150-$700, ductless mini-splits $2,000-$8,000 per zone, central AC replacement with existing ducts $3,500-$12,000, and full new installs with ductwork $7,000-$20,000. SEER rating, tonnage, and brand significantly affect pricing.
